Overview of Visiting Hours

Visiting hours at Louis Leipoldt Maternity are designed with the welfare of mothers and newborns in mind. This schedule provides flexibility while ensuring mothers have ample time to recover, rest, and bond with their babies.

  • General Visitors: Generally, visitors are welcome during afternoon slots (14:00 – 16:00) and evening slots (19:00 – 20:00). Verification with the maternity ward in advance is recommended due to potential changes or special occasions.
  • Children’s Visits: For health reasons, siblings can visit but other children are often restricted. Ensure siblings are in good health before bringing them.
